Warrants (SRTAW) represents a derivative security tied to the underlying common stock of Strata Critical Medical Inc. As of the current reporting period, no recent earnings data is available for this warrants security. Unlike traditional equity securities, warrant securities do not generate traditional revenue or earnings figures in the conventional sense. Forward Guidance

Forward guidance for warrant securities typically relates to key dates and conditions rather than financial projections. SRTAW warrant holders should be aware of several important considerations when evaluating their position. The time value component of warrant pricing is subject to decay as the security approaches its expiration date. Investors should monitor the time remaining until expiration and assess whether the underlying stock price has sufficient volatility and upward potential to make exercising the warrants attractive relative to the exercise price. Additionally, warrant holders should consider the relationship between the current market price of the underlying Strata Critical Medical Inc. common stock and the warrant exercise price. If the underlying stock trades below the exercise price, the warrants would be considered "out of the money" and would have limited intrinsic value, retaining only time value that diminishes over time. Liquidity conditions in the secondary market for SRTAW may also affect the ability to buy or sell positions at favorable prices. Investors should review trading volume and bid-ask spreads when considering adjustments to their warrant positions. Warrant securities typically exhibit higher volatility than their underlying common stock due to their leveraged exposure characteristics. This means that percentage changes in the underlying stock price may result in amplified percentage movements in warrant prices, presenting both opportunities and risks for investors.
